I bult this piece by painting the background from my imagination (as are most of my backgrounds) and then I had this reference photo of the elk (which I tweeked...the steam, turned head and the attitude) and placed him in there. I'm still not sure of his placement...I think I cropped too much of his legs. Oh well, it sold so on to more paintings...
